Enter one word that applies to all the following blanks, starting with 'v'. Spelling counts. Look it up Ch1 Slides if you are not sure. Statistical techniques are useful to describe and understand ____________________. By ____________________, we mean successive observations of a system or phenomenon do not produce exactly the same result.

Answers

Answer:

Variability

Step-by-step explanation:

Variability in simple terms may be described as differences in measurement or reading of a certain construct or phenomenon. Variability measures include range, standard deviation or variance. In most cases, variation or degree of Variability is measured about a central value called the mean. This is because same measurement about a certain phenomenon or study would usually not yield the same result value. Hence, the mean is used to record the average of these measurement and the differences in each measurement from the mean is also recorded, this is called the standard deviation which is a Variability measure.

Thus VARIABILITY means successive observation of a phenomenon do not yield exactly the same result.

As a salesperson for an electronic parts distributor, you are given two options for your salary structure. The first option has a base salary of $300 a week plus 4% of all sales made. The second option has a base salary of $100 plus 7.5% commission on all sales. Find the sales amount that will result in the two options having the same weekly salary.

Answers

Answer:

The amount of sale is approximately 5714.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let x be the sales made that will result to the same salary and let y be the same weekly salary.

We can represent both salaries as follows:

300 + 0.04x = y

100 + 0.075x = y

Subtracting the second equation from the first, we have:

200 – 0.035x = 0

0.035x= 200

x = 200/0.035

x ≈ 5714.

Therefore, the amount of sale is approximately 5714.
